### Pattern 2A: Selector with Lists (CRITICAL)
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**⚠️ Important Lesson from Chat Message Fix:**
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
When using Selector with Lists, the equality comparison must detect ALL changes, not just length.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**❌ WRONG - Only compares length:**
|
|
|
|
|
```dart
|
|
|
|
|
class _MyListState {
|
|
|
|
|
final List<MyModel> items;
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
const _MyListState({required this.items});
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
@override
|
|
|
|
|
bool operator ==(Object other) =>
|
|
|
|
|
other is _MyListState &&
|
|
|
|
|
items.length == other.items.length; // ❌ Misses in-place modifications!
|
|
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**✅ CORRECT - Compares length + identifying property:**
|
|
|
|
|
```dart
|
|
|
|
|
class _ChatMessagesState {
|
|
|
|
|
final List<SingleUserChatModel> messages;
|
|
|
|
|
final int messageCount;
|
|
|
|
|
final DateTime? lastMessageTime; // 🔑 KEY: Detects new messages
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
_ChatMessagesState({required this.messages})
|
|
|
|
|
: messageCount = messages.length,
|
|
|
|
|
lastMessageTime = messages.isNotEmpty ? messages.first.createdDate : null;
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
@override
|
|
|
|
|
bool operator ==(Object other) =>
|
|
|
|
|
identical(this, other) ||
|
|
|
|
|
other is _ChatMessagesState &&
|
|
|
|
|
messageCount == other.messageCount &&
|
|
|
|
|
lastMessageTime == other.lastMessageTime; // ✅ Detects all changes
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
@override
|
|
|
|
|
int get hashCode => Object.hash(messageCount, lastMessageTime);
|
|
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**Why This Matters:**
|
|
|
|
|
- When list modified in-place (insert/remove), list reference stays same
|
|
|
|
|
- Length-only comparison can miss modifications
|
|
|
|
|
- Timestamp/ID comparison catches every change reliably
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**Best Practices for Lists:**
|
|
|
|
|
```dart
|
|
|
|
|
// ✅ Option 1: Length + first/last item property
|
|
|
|
|
lastMessageTime: messages.isNotEmpty ? messages.first.createdDate : null
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
// ✅ Option 2: Length + item ID
|
|
|
|
|
lastItemId: messages.isNotEmpty ? messages.first.id : null
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
// ✅ Option 3: If provider always creates new list
|
|
|
|
|
identical(items, other.items) // Only if new list instance every time
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
// ❌ NEVER: Length only
|
|
|
|
|
items.length == other.items.length // Can miss in-place modifications
|
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
**Real-World Issue Fixed:**
|
|
|
|
|
- **Problem:** Chat messages not refreshing on receiver phone
|
|
|
|
|
- **Cause:** Selector compared length only, missed new text messages
|
|
|
|
|
- **Fix:** Added timestamp comparison → now works perfectly
|
|
|
|
|
- **File:** `lib/modules/cx_module/chat/chat_page.dart` (lines 73-90)
